The Evolution and Architecture of Live Streaming Technology
Introduction
Live streaming technology has transformed how individuals and organizations share real-time video content across the internet. From its early days as a niche hobbyist pursuit, live streaming has become a core component of modern digital entertainment, education, corporate communications, and social interaction. This article explores the technical foundations, key components, and operational considerations that make live streaming possible at scale.
Core Components of a Live Streaming System
A live streaming workflow typically consists of three primary stages: capture, encoding, and distribution. The capture stage involves acquiring video and audio signals from sources such as cameras, microphones, or screen recording software. These raw signals are then passed to an encoder, which compresses the data into a digital format suitable for transmission over the internet. Common encoding standards include H.264 and the more recent H.265 (HEVC), which balance video quality with bandwidth efficiency. The encoded stream is then sent to a media server or content delivery network (CDN) for distribution to end viewers.
Encoding and Transcoding
Encoding is a critical step that determines the quality and compatibility of a live stream. Real-time encoders, whether hardware-based or software-based, must process video frames with minimal latency while maintaining a consistent bitrate. Software encoders such as those built into popular broadcasting applications often leverage the processing power of a computer’s central processing unit (CPU) or graphics processing unit (GPU). Hardware encoders, common in professional environments, offer dedicated chips that reduce system load and improve reliability. Transcoding, or converting the single encoded stream into multiple renditions at different resolutions and bitrates, allows viewers with varying internet speeds to access the stream without buffering. This adaptive bitrate streaming is essential for reaching a broad audience on platforms that support mobile and desktop devices.
Content Delivery and Latency
Once a stream is encoded and transcoded, it is distributed through a content delivery network, a system of geographically distributed servers that cache and relay video data to viewers. The CDN minimizes the distance data must travel, reducing lag and buffering. Latency, the delay between a live event occurring and a viewer seeing it, is a critical metric. Traditional streaming using HTTP-based protocols such as HLS (HTTP Live Streaming) can introduce delays of ten to thirty seconds. For interactive applications like gaming or live auctions, lower latency is desirable. Newer protocols such as WebRTC (Web Real-Time Communication) and SRT (Secure Reliable Transport) can achieve sub-two-second latency, enabling real-time conversations and synchronized viewing experiences. king 88.
Platform and Backend Infrastructure
Behind every live stream lies a robust backend infrastructure that handles user authentication, chat systems, stream scheduling, and analytics. Cloud computing services provide scalable infrastructure that automatically adjusts to spikes in viewership. Microservices architecture is common, where separate services manage stream ingestion, recording, thumbnail generation, and moderation. Many platforms also implement digital rights management (DRM) to protect copyrighted content. The backend must ensure low-latency communication between the broadcaster and viewers, often using WebSocket connections for real-time chat and notifications. Monitoring tools track bitrate, dropped frames, and viewer counts to alert operators to potential issues.
Emerging Technologies and Trends
Artificial intelligence and machine learning are increasingly integrated into live streaming. AI-powered tools can automatically generate captions, moderate chat for inappropriate content, and enhance video quality by upscaling lower-resolution streams. Edge computing, where processing occurs closer to the viewer, reduces latency further by handling transcoding and rendering at local nodes. The rollout of 5G networks promises to improve mobile live streaming with higher bandwidth and lower latency, enabling high-quality broadcasts from virtually anywhere. Virtual and augmented reality are also beginning to merge with live streaming, allowing viewers to experience immersive 360-degree feeds or interactive overlays during live events.
Operational Considerations
Successful live streaming requires careful planning. Content creators must select appropriate encoding settings based on their network upload speed and target audience. A stable wired internet connection is generally preferred over Wi-Fi to avoid interruptions. Security considerations include using stream keys that are kept private, enabling encryption, and implementing access controls for private streams. Regular testing of the entire pipeline—from capture to playback—helps identify bottlenecks before a live event. For large-scale broadcasts, redundant encoders and backup internet connections provide failover protection. Post-event analytics, such as peak concurrent viewer counts and geographic distribution, inform future broadcasts and resource allocation.
Conclusion
Live streaming technology continues to advance rapidly, driven by consumer demand for real-time, interactive content. The combination of efficient encoding, adaptive streaming, global CDNs, and emerging technologies like AI and 5G has made live streaming accessible to anyone with a smartphone and an internet connection. As hardware improves and protocols evolve, the threshold for high-quality, low-latency live streaming will continue to lower, opening new possibilities for entertainment, education, and professional communication. Understanding the underlying technology empowers broadcasters and organizations to deliver reliable, engaging live experiences to audiences around the world.